FENDI announces the opening of its new boutique located in Königsallee, renowned fashion district in Düsseldorf, Germany.
The 460sqm space welcomes the entire FENDI universe, where Women’s and Men’s full collections are carefully showcased on two levels, expressing an aesthetic design through a double height void emphasized by led arches, an iconic FENDI signature, reminding of the façade of Palazzo della Civiltà Italiana, FENDI’s headquarters in Rome, which result in an airy and graceful space. The façade, that reveals the 2-floor store thanks to a see-through effect that create a dialogue between inside and outside, maintains its original aesthetic to preserve the building’s original appearance.
Upon entering, guests immediately discover the ground floor divided into two areas by the light metal pink staircase and the matching colour marble floor, which spaces out the elegant use of materials, alternating Women’s leathergoods and accessories, displayed on champagne metal shelves with silver metal drawers while Men’s categories are characterized by niches with green silk backdrop and geometric pattern carpet, a reference to the archives and Karl Lagerfeld design, that carry a masculine feeling.
The stunning element that catches the attention is the floating mirrored glass walkway aimed at connecting the glass elevator with the rest of the first floor, reachable also through the precious staircase, both part of a special atmosphere created by a warm lighting with a focus on the products, as if they were works of art.
Walking up the staircase the first floor opens to an open space area with a soft palette of ivory and pink tones, accentuated by hues of warm gold, which is dedicated to Women’s ready-to-wear, fur and shoes, where shelves and free-standing elements in Arabescato Vagli marble, typical of the architecture of Roman churches to convey grandeur atmosphere, and gold alternate, overlooking into the void.
From here guests can have access to the scenographic, but intimate, VIP area characterized by azul metal walls and Ocean Storm light blue marble floor that can be privatized with ivory velvet curtains that once closed creates a private and cosy space. The special lounge offers a selection of pearl color bespoke pieces of FENDI Casa furniture and encloses a virtual sale niche, hidden by sliding walls and marble backdrop, enriching the clients’ experiences inside the boutiques.
To celebrate the boutique Grand Opening, FENDI taps Pepi Erdbories, a German contemporary artist represented by Baodt.Art Gallery, to customize a white canvas Peekaboo through her own vision of art. With her works she always tries to create an outer framework for a following inner play of thoughts. By combining abstract art and text art, she invites viewers to identify themselves with her work individually and connect their own story to it. Her main goal is to convey a good, empowering feeling as well as getting in touch with the subconscious mind. The bag features two powerful messages handwritten by the artist on each side of the bag, painted by hand in the iconic FENDI yellow colour.
In addition, FENDI displays a special selection of Peekaboo bags realized over the years by other famous international artists, designers and celebrities, who transformed through their work the iconic FENDI bag – realized by Silvia Venturini Fendi in 2008 – into a piece of art during special happenings for FENDI. In a tribute to craftsmanship, design and art world and to the Peekaboo itself, the selection includes the Artist Peekaboo customized by Dutch designer Sabine Marcelis and Hong Kong jeweller, philanthropist and businesswoman Michelle Ong on the occasion of the Peekaboo 10th anniversary, along with the Selleria Peekaboo designed by Aranda Lasch for Design Miami/ 2010. Selected bags from the 2014 Peekaboo Project will also be exhibited, including the ones by Zaha Hadid, Cara Delevingne, Jerry Hall, Kate Adie, Gwyneth Paltrow, Georgia May Jagger, Naomie Harris and Tanya Ling.
